Review titled Appalling Service.
Rated 1 star out of 5
by Keith Bagnall - Posted on 14 December 2023
I occasionally get gout in my foot, normally I take a couple of Naproxen tablets and it goes away. I tried to buy some from a chemist as was told it is now a prescription drug and I would have to ask my doctors, no problem I thought. I contacted my doctors and was told I might have to see a doctor but they would message the doctor and see if they would prescribe without seeing me and they would call me back to let me know. Day 1 no phone call. Day 2 I telephoned the surgery and was told the person had not read their messages, as soon as they had they would call me. I telephoned again because I was hobbling around with a pain in my foot and was told the person still hadn't read their messages and was told the surgery has 9000 patients and only one doctor was working that day. So day 3 still no feed back from surgery, tried to make an appointment to see a doctor at 8 o'clock and was automatically put in a queue of 25 people which from experience I would have been waiting at least 45 minutes so I finished the call. Out of interest I telephoned 12 minutes later only to be told all appointments for that day had gone, so even if I had waited I still would not have got an appointment. So I guess I will have to keep taking pain killers and hope that eventually the gout will ease enough for me to walk properly. This was so simple to resolve but the staff have made it so difficult.
